A 19-year-old hit a pedestrian while riding an electronic scooter on March 16 at approximately 10:45 am.

Approaching the back door of the Yishun Emerald condominium at Canberra Drive, Sembawang, Derrick Gan Zhong Kang decided to overtake another e-scooter rider

Ms. Daisy Lim, 56, was walking through the door at the time

Gan hit Ms. Lim, leaving it covered with cuts. She was taken to Khoo Teck Puat Hospital and received five days of medical leave.

On Tuesday (July 24), the 19-year-old pleaded guilty in a district court for hurting Ms. Lim.

Gan, who was not represented, asked District Judge Eddy Tham to give him another chance

. should be sentenced on August 7, said that he does not want to go to jail and is willing to compensate Ms. Lim.

The amount has not been declared in the court documents.
